Output 7f2a66da5afb6f8039ad457603442bedfc36873c9adc95b9c46f121d31950026:1

value
44294928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a7a0bb248b8e716991b41abe1b2f52cfc1ae32f OP_EQUALVERIFY OP_CHECKSIG
address
17noD5ZPvH2wDvtLdPcSvA7YL3tBHTw6e5
transaction
7f2a66da5afb6f8039ad457603442bedfc36873c9adc95b9c46f121d31950026
confirmations
253092
spent
true